Abstract
The products of thermally-degraded Cymbopogon citratus were evaluated for nematicidal activity as an alternative of toxic synthetics. The products exhibited moderate nematicidal activity, but not as significantly (p<0.05) effective as carbofuran, a synthetic nematicide. Thermally degraded products of fresh Cymbopogon citratus (CMGC/th/fresh) was the most promising at 90 mg/mL and could be used in place of the toxic synthetic nematicide.
